Yemen ceasefire hopes rise

AFP is reporting that the Yemeni government has drawn up a ceasefire timetable and relayed it to the Houthi rebels via an intermediary. There is also talk of having the ceasefire implementation overseen by parliamentary committees.

This is beginning to look more hopeful. At least one previous ceasefire attempt failed through lack of an implementation mechanism.
